Deck Repair Built for Ferndale's Weather
Ferndale sits close enough to Puget Sound and the Nooksack River lowlands that decks here take a different kind of beating than decks twenty miles inland. Salt-laden air off the water accelerates corrosion on fasteners, hardware, and any exposed metal connectors. Long stretches of driving rain push moisture into every seam, joint, and screw hole a deck has. And the mild, wet winters that make Whatcom County green also make it a moss factory — moss holds water against wood and finishes for months at a time, which is exactly what rot needs to get started. We repair decks all over the Bellingham area, and Ferndale properties consistently show a specific pattern of damage tied to these conditions. Knowing that pattern before we ever pull up a board is what separates a repair that lasts from one that's patched over and quietly failing again in two years.

What Ferndale Decks Actually Need
Most deck problems we find in this area aren't dramatic. They're slow, moisture-driven failures that started small and got ignored because the deck still looked fine from a few feet away. A correct repair addresses the cause, not just the symptom.
Moss and Surface Moisture
Moss on a deck surface isn't just cosmetic. It traps rainwater against the wood or composite decking, blocks airflow, and keeps the surface damp long after the rest of the yard has dried out. On wood decks this leads directly to surface rot and slick, unsafe footing. On composite decking, moss buildup in the grain pattern can stain the material and, over years, contribute to fiber degradation in lower-quality boards. Regular removal matters, but so does making sure the deck was built with enough drainage and spacing to shed water in the first place — a lot of the moss problems we see trace back to boards installed too tight or a structure with poor airflow underneath.
Fastener and Hardware Corrosion
The salt air common in Ferndale's stretch of Whatcom County shortens the working life of standard fasteners, joist hangers, and structural screws. We regularly find galvanized hardware that's rusting from the inside of the connection outward — not visible until a board starts to feel loose or a railing develops play. Once corrosion compromises a fastener's grip, that connection isn't just cosmetic anymore; it's a structural point that can fail under load.
Ledger Board and Rim Joist Rot
The ledger board — where the deck attaches to the house — is the single most important structural connection on most decks, and it's also the one most exposed to prolonged wetting if flashing was installed incorrectly or has failed. Combine that with our area's rain volume and you get a common, serious problem: a deck that looks solid but is only loosely attached to the house because the ledger has been rotting from behind, out of sight.
Post Bases and Footings
Posts set directly in soil or in contact with standing water are vulnerable to rot right at the base, which is also the point carrying the most load. In low-lying or poorly drained yards around Ferndale, we see this more often than homeowners expect, especially on older decks built before raised post bases became standard practice.
Signs Your Deck Needs Repair, Not Just Cleaning
- Boards that feel spongy, springy, or soft when you walk across them
- Railings or posts with noticeable side-to-side movement
- Visible gaps, dark staining, or splitting around the ledger board where the deck meets the house
- Rust streaks running down from screws, bolts, or joist hangers
- Moss or algae that returns within weeks of cleaning
- Stairs that feel less solid than they used to, especially near the base of the stringers
- Fasteners backing out or visibly loose at the deck surface
- A musty smell coming from underneath the deck structure
Any one of these on its own might be minor. Two or more together, especially involving the ledger, posts, or stairs, usually means the damage has moved past the surface and into structural territory.
Repair vs. Replacement: How We Decide
Not every deck problem calls for tearing the whole thing out, and we don't default to recommending full replacement just because it's a bigger job. The honest answer depends on what's actually damaged and how much of the structure it affects.
| Condition Found | Typical Approach | Why |
|---|---|---|
| A few soft or split boards, structure sound | Board-by-board replacement | Isolated surface damage doesn't require touching the frame |
| Rotted or corroded ledger connection | Ledger repair with proper flashing correction | This is a structural safety issue and gets fixed regardless of the rest of the deck's condition |
| Loose railings or posts | Hardware and post base repair | Often a fastener or connection issue, not a full rebuild |
| Widespread rot across joists and framing | Partial or full rebuild | Once the frame is compromised in multiple places, patching isn't cost-effective or safe long-term |
| Deck over 20-25 years old with recurring issues | Full evaluation before committing to repair | Older framing may be undersized or built to outdated codes, worth knowing before investing more into it |
We'll tell you plainly if a repair is a temporary fix versus a long-term one, and we'll tell you when replacement is genuinely the more cost-effective path rather than sinking money into a structure that keeps needing attention.
What a Correct Repair Involves
A repair that actually holds up starts with finding every source of moisture intrusion, not just the board that's visibly failed. That usually means checking the ledger flashing, looking underneath the deck at joists and beams, testing posts and railings for movement, and inspecting fastener condition, not just replacing what's obviously broken on top. Where corrosion-prone hardware caused the original failure, we replace it with fasteners and connectors rated for exterior, high-moisture use so the same problem doesn't recur in a few years. Where flashing was missing or installed wrong at the ledger, we correct that as part of the repair, because reattaching a board to a ledger that's still trapping water just delays the next repair call.
Our Process for Ferndale Deck Repairs
1. On-Site Inspection
We walk the entire deck structure, not just the area you're concerned about, checking boards, framing, railings, stairs, posts, and the ledger connection. Problems in one area often point to a related issue elsewhere.
2. Clear, Honest Findings
You get a straight explanation of what's damaged, what's causing it, and what your real options are, including cost ranges for different levels of repair. No pressure toward the most expensive option.
3. Repair Plan and Timeline
We scope the work, source materials suited to our climate, and give you a realistic timeline that accounts for Whatcom County's rain patterns, since deck repair work depends on dry working conditions for proper adhesion and fastening.
4. The Repair Itself
Structural issues get addressed first, ledger and framing before surface boards, so the finished repair is sound underneath, not just cosmetically clean on top.
5. Final Walkthrough
We walk the deck with you when the work is done so you can see and feel the difference, and so you know what maintenance, if any, will keep it in good shape going forward.
Maintenance That Actually Extends Deck Life Here
Given our moss season and rain volume, a little seasonal attention goes a long way toward avoiding repeat repairs.
- Sweep debris and standing leaves off the deck surface regularly through fall, when they trap moisture fastest
- Remove moss as soon as it appears rather than letting it establish over a season
- Check and reseal or restain wood decking on the schedule appropriate to the product, since our rain shortens the effective life of most finishes
- Keep gutters and downspouts near the deck clear so runoff isn't dumping extra water onto or under the structure
- Look underneath the deck once or twice a year for standing water, soft framing, or signs of pests, which are often easier to catch early from below than from the surface
